Common Use Cases for TECHTONGDA Milling Machines
TECHTONGDA mills shine in scenarios requiring ultrafine particle reduction. Laboratories use them for pharmaceutical compounding, where uniform powders ensure accurate dosing. In materials science, they process ceramics and minerals for research prototypes. Hobbyists in pyrotechnics or cosmetics appreciate the wet milling for slurries, while small manufacturers grind pigments or chemicals efficiently.

How to Select the Right TECHTONGDA Model
With focused offerings like the Ceramic Ball Mill, evaluate based on capacity and material type. For 11LB ball loads, it's perfect for batches up to several kilograms. Test speed ranges to match your grind size, lower for coarse, higher for nano-particles. Check chamber volume against your workflow; larger for production, smaller for R&D. Always verify voltage compatibility to avoid setup issues.
Maintenance is straightforward: regular ball inspection and chamber rinsing extend lifespan. TECHTONGDA's build quality rivals premium brands, offering longevity without frequent replacements.
